ABSTRACT
With the development of Industry 4.0 and 5G, an environment for high-speed communication and process auto-mation is provided in various areas. Process automation is associated with monitoring various parameters, for which Internet of Things (IoT) technologies can be successfully applied, which enable the connection of many devices that generate a large volume of data. This data is very often the subject of cyberattacks and solutions are constantly sought to improve security. This paper presents a comparative evaluation of simulation products that allow the study of aspects related to the security of one of the most common technologies for wireless sensor networks for IoT – ZigBee. The comparison of simulation products was carried out using the complex assess-ment method.
